I caught a few small bass on Tue. I never know what to call this piece of water so I started calling it Lake L.B.B. because it is located where Luna, George Bush, and Beltline all meet. I had a 30 minute window where I caught 5 bass really quick and then it stopped. It was really fun while it lasted. I was using a green/red Rooster Tail, if anyone is interested.
